Brief Summary
Intermittent claudication is a condition where a patient suffers with cramp-like pain experienced in the muscles of the legs (often the calf muscles) brought on by walking and relieved by stopping wal...

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- • Rutherford b/c intermittent claudication with stable symptoms for 6 months with a decision not to undergo any revascularization.
Exclusion
- • Critical limb ischaemia
- Previous external ear surgery
- Patients with either a cochlear implant or a permanent pacemaker / cardiac defibrillator device
- Significant cardiorespiratory or musculoskeletal disease (as determined by the medical team) that would contraindicate a 6-minute walk test
